In recent years, the use of electronic cigarettes has become increasingly popular, and many people are curious about how these devices function. Essentially, an e-cigarette is a device designed to simulate smoking by creating a vapor that is inhaled by the user. Unlike traditional cigarettes, e-cigarettes do not burn tobacco. Instead, they use a battery to heat a liquid, often referred to as e-liquid or vape juice, resulting in vapor production. This liquid typically contains nicotine, flavorings, and other chemicals.

Components of An E-Cigarette

To understand how e-cigarettes work, it is essential to understand their main components. An e-cigarette usually consists of a battery, atomizer, and a cartridge or tank. The battery provides the necessary power to heat the atomizer. The atomizer then heats up the e-liquid, turning it into vapor that the user inhales through the mouthpiece. Depending on the design, the cartridge many times doubles as the mouthpiece.

Battery: The Power Source

The battery is a crucial part of the e-cigarette. It powers the device and comes in different capacities, affecting the usage duration. Some batteries are rechargeable, and others are replaceable, providing flexibility based on user preference.

Atomizer: Creating the Vapor

The atomizer is a small heating element that vaporizes the e-liquid. It’s often composed of a coil and a wick; the wick absorbs the e-liquid, while the coil heats to convert it into vapor. The atomizer’s resistance is measured in ohms, which can affect the amount of vapor produced.

Cartridge or Tank: Holding the E-Liquid

The cartridge holds the e-liquid, which is essential for generating vapor. There are different types of cartridges, such as disposable pre-filled ones or refillable tanks, giving users options based on convenience and preference.

How E-Liquid Contributes to Functionality

E-liquid is crucial as it determines the flavor and nicotine strength of the vapor. It typically consists of propylene glycol (PG) or vegetable glycerin (VG), which can affect the throat hit and vapor density. PG provides a stronger hit, while VG results in denser clouds. Users can choose different nicotine levels, ranging from high to zero.

Safety Considerations

While e-cigarettes are generally considered safer than traditional smoking, there are potential risks. It’s important to ensure devices are purchased from reputable sources and properly maintained. Avoiding counterfeit products can minimize the risk of malfunction and exposure to harmful substances.
